Job Title: Oil Processing Technician I
Department: Processing
Reports to : Manufacturing Manager
FLSA Status: Non-Exempt, Hourly
Location: Quincy, Florida
POSITION SUMMARY
The Oil Processing Technician I will be part of the team responsible for weighing, measuring, and filling medical marijuana derivatives, in the appropriate container for resale at company dispensaries, while meeting tight production deadlines.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Under direction of the Oil Production Manager, the Oil Production Supervisor, and Team Leads, duties shall include, but not be limited to the following:
Responsible for properly weighing, measuring, and filling various types of medical marijuana derivatives into the appropriate container accurately and efficiently
Perform and document necessary quality checks of incoming material, process, and finished goods
Label containers with the appropriate product labels and variable data label, any state mandated tags, tamper tape as necessary
Package, document, and ensure proper counts and tracking documentation of case packs.
Maintain quality control measures to ensure high quality packaging of product
Maintain the highest levels of cleanliness and sterility within the packaging area per cGMP and Trulieve standards
